Course Content

• Promote communication in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Engage in personal development in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Promote equality and inclusion in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Principles for implementing duty of care in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Understand the role of the social care worker
• Support individuals to meet personal care needs
• Contribute to health and safety in health and social care
• Handle information in health and social care settings
• Support individuals with specific communication needs
• Support individuals with self-directed support.

Career path

Care Assistant Provide personal care and support to individuals in residential or community settings, assisting with daily tasks and promoting independence.
Support Worker Offer practical and emotional support to vulnerable individuals, helping them to live fulfilling lives and access necessary services.
Healthcare Assistant Work alongside healthcare professionals to deliver high-quality care to patients in hospitals, clinics, or home settings.
Social Care Worker Support individuals with social, emotional, and practical needs, advocating for their rights and well-being within the community.
Residential Support Worker Provide round-the-clock care and supervision to individuals living in residential care homes, ensuring their safety and comfort.
